So my LS is a 2003 and it's beginning to show some signs of wear and tear being a 10 year old car, but I plan to keep it until the wheels fall off. I have some scratches here and there and a dent in the passengers side door (I hate shopping carts) as well as some other minor issues but it still runs fairly well and I'm at about 130,000. It was finally nice out over the last couple days so I spent a few hours detailing the interior and another few hours detailing the exterior and then snapped a few shots. Personally, I think it looks a lot better in person.

Recent and fairly recent upgrades have mostly dealt with suspension issues.
New front sway bar
New front tie rods
(AND STILL HAVE A CLUNK)
New rear stabilizer bar
New rear tie rods
New rear LCAs
(SOLVED MY OBNOXIOUS SQUEAK ISSUE)
New struts all around
(all above parts motorcraft)

Eibach Springs
(Brembo rotors w Akebono pads). I used to have some ebay bargain drilled/slotted rotors from IRotors and never really liked em. So far, I love the new setup.

Other mods (most of which I have previously posted photos of):
Pioneer head unit
Plasti-dip Jag 19's which will need some refinishing
LSE Front bumper
Magnaflow mufflers and 4" slant cut tips

The last photo is of the amp mounted to the rear deck, which powers the 6x8 speakers where the old subs were.

How do you have front strut mount covers and my '03 doesn't? Did you get those from a Gen I?
 
thanks for the compliments guys!

blwnbyu - I was hesitant to do the black rims, but I got bored with the chrome. Its plasti dip though so if I want to go chrome again I can peel it right off.

stumpie - I purchased the mount covers on ebay. 03+ don't have them.

Tony Starks - They are Lloyd mats. Black with silver "Lincoln" lettering and silver Lincoln star. I bought them through LSKoncepts when it was still around so I've had them for a while.
